Feyerabend explained the impossibility of commensurable science claiming, “The problem is the result of a conflict between an expectation and an observation, which, in its turn, is formed by the expectation” (Feyerabend, 1989; pp. 96). He means that the interpretation of observations is indirectly influenced by preexisting theoretical assumptions. It is therefore impossible to describe or evaluate observations independently of past conclusions and theory. It is impossible to compare two paradigms in a meaningful way.

Kuhn claimed that “The normal-scientific tradition that emerges from a scientific revolution is not only incompatible but often actually incommensurable with that which has gone before”. Let’s break that down, what does that mean really?

Some interpret Khun’s statement as he saying, “Choices between competing scientific theories must be irrational”. The paradigm shift, according to Khun is an abrupt “sudden and unstructured event”. No one can truly reason oneself into the new paradigm built on the old one. I would say it’s like saying the Earth is flat and then Earth is round, the first cannot really be an argument for the second. Kuhn describes the process of adopting a new paradigm as a “conversion experience”, which means it can only be made on faith, maybe at least to start with until we find new tools to explain it.

Another book I read that referred to the problem from a different perspective is “The User Illusion” by Norretrander. He explained the importance of discarded information as his leading metaphor for human communication. Norretrander compares consciousness to a concept invented by the computer scientist Alan Kay, ”the user illusion”. As we are sitting at the computer putting documents into folders or into the trash can, “the operator is under a machine-induced hallucination”. Inside the computer components there are no documents, trash cans, words or letters, just electricity engaging the ones and zeros of binary code. Instead of overwhelming the user with a flood of useless information, the computer projects a simple array of metaphors, like icons that can be manipulated to operate quickly. In a similar way, the brain, throwing away unneeded data, generates its own user illusion, the interpretation called consciousness.

A computer contains many million 0’s or 1’s. But this is nothing that the users are aware of or even need to be aware of to do their tasks. Moving from physics to psychology, more specifically the notion of consciousness and its role in our human/collective communication, he explained that it is estimated that of the millions of bits of information coming through the senses at any moment, most is thrown away. It is only a tiny part that enters into human awareness/consciousness. From this the brain creates a picture, a perception of what we mistakenly call reality. That kills the creativity and playfulness which might give us the access to what is under the surface of the computer screen.In 2012 a famous and well established mathematician claimed to have solved the ABC conjecture problem.

This problem is claimed to be most important unsolved problem in mathematical analysis. In January 2012 the internet exploded and even the mainstream media shared the story. “World’s Most Complex Mathematical Theory Cracked” announced the Telegraph, “Possible Breakthrough in ABC Conjecture” the New York Times reported. The problem though was that the mathematic community refused to accept it, not because it was wrong but because they couldn’t understand the proof. What many mathematicians were discovering when they rushed to Mochizuki’s website, was that the proof was impossible to read.

A blogger wrote “It was not just gibberish to the average layman. It was gibberish to the math community as well”. “It’s very, very weird” wrote Columbia University professor Johan de Jong, who works in a related field of mathematics. Mochizuki had created so many new mathematical tools and brought together so many disparate strands of mathematics that his paper was populated with vocabulary that nobody could understand. It was totally novel, and totally mystifying.

Many claim that Mochizuki may have found the key that would redefine number theory as we know it. He has, perhaps, explained a new path into the dark unknown of mathematics but for now as one blogger wrote “His footsteps are untraceable.
